📚 Understanding Fair Value Gaps
What Are Fair Value Gaps?
Fair Value Gaps (FVGs), also known as imbalances or inefficiencies, are zones where price moved so quickly that normal trading didn't occur. They represent:
• Price Imbalance - One-sided aggressive buying or selling
• Unfair Pricing - Some participants didn't get to trade at these levels
• Market Inefficiency - Supply/demand equilibrium was disrupted
• Rebalancing Zones - Price often returns to "fill" these gaps
The ICT Concept:
Markets constantly seek equilibrium (fair value). When price moves too fast:
1. It leaves gaps where normal trading didn't happen
2. These gaps represent unfair/inefficient pricing
3. Market has a tendency to return and "rebalance"
4. Smart money knows this and trades the fills
Why FVGs Work:
• Unfilled Orders - Traders who missed the move have pending orders in the gap
• Algorithmic Trading - Algos programmed to exploit inefficiencies
• Market Psychology - Traders notice gaps and place orders there
• Institutional Behavior - Smart money uses gaps for entries/exits
FVG vs Regular Gaps:
• Regular Gaps - Occur at market open, between daily closes
• Fair Value Gaps - Occur intraday, between 3 consecutive candles
• FVGs happen more frequently and on all timeframes
• FVGs are more tradeable for intraday/swing traders

🟢 Bullish Fair Value Gaps Explained
How They Form:
Bullish FVG requires 3 candles:
1. Candle 1 - Any candle (sets the high reference)
2. Candle 2 - Strong bullish candle (aggressive buying)
3. Candle 3 - Continuation candle
The Gap: Candle 3's LOW is above Candle 1's HIGH = Gap left unfilled
Visual Example:
```
Candle 3: Low at $105 ──────────┐
│ ← GAP (Bullish FVG)
Candle 2: Strong bullish │
│
Candle 1: High at $100 ──────────┘
```
What It Means:
• Price jumped from $100 to $105+ so fast, no trading occurred in between
• This $100-$105 zone is "unfair" - buyers/sellers didn't get to trade there
• Market may return to this zone to "rebalance"
• When price returns, it often acts as support

🔴 Bearish Fair Value Gaps Explained
How They Form:
Bearish FVG requires 3 candles:
1. Candle 1 - Any candle (sets the low reference)
2. Candle 2 - Strong bearish candle (aggressive selling)
3. Candle 3 - Continuation candle
The Gap: Candle 3's HIGH is below Candle 1's LOW = Gap left unfilled
Visual Example:
```
Candle 1: Low at $100 ───────────┐
│ ← GAP (Bearish FVG)
Candle 2: Strong bearish │
│
Candle 3: High at $95 ───────────┘
```
What It Means:
• Price dropped from $100 to $95 so fast, no trading occurred in between
• This $95-$100 zone is "unfair" - buyers/sellers didn't get to trade there
• Market may return to this zone to "rebalance"
• When price returns, it often acts as resistance

Technical Details
Calculation Method
The indicator uses TradingView's built-in `ta.vwap()` function, which calculates:
**VWAP** = Σ(Price × Volume) / Σ(Volume)
The calculation resets based on the selected anchor period, ensuring accurate volume-weighted averages for each timeframe.
Event-Based Anchors
For Earnings, Dividends, and Splits anchors, the indicator uses TradingView's data requests to detect these events automatically, ensuring precise reset points.

How It Works
1. Session Detection: The indicator checks the current bar's time against user-defined sessions in the selected timezone. Sessions are non-overlapping and assume a 24-hour cycle.
2. Box and Line Drawing:
o At session start, a box is initialized from the open/high/low.
o As the session progresses, the box expands to capture the live high/low, with the midline updating dynamically.
o Upon session end, final high/low are locked, and extension lines are drawn horizontally.
o Extensions persist until price fully mitigates the level (high ≥ level and low ≤ level) or the hardstop time is passed.
3. Asia Ratio Calculation: Maintains a historical array of Asia range ratios (high-low divided by open). The current ratio is compared to the average over the lookback to classify as "Above Avg" or "Below Avg".
4. Key Generation and Lookup:
o A unique key is built from four binary/ternary codes: Asia classification (0/1), London open vs. Asia mid (0/1), London sweep type (0=high only, 1=low only, 2=both, 3=none), NY open vs. London mid (0/1).
o This key queries a hardcoded map of historical data (e.g., "0_0_0_0" for above-avg Asia, above-mid London open, high-only sweep, above-mid NY open).
o Data includes sample size, probabilities, failure rates, and median penetrations, all derived from historical analysis (total samples across all keys: approximately 5,000+ based on the provided mappings).
5. Table Rendering: On the last bar (real-time), the table populates with the current key's data. Metrics are formatted for readability, and penetration values are scaled to the current London high/low in points for context.
6. Performance Notes: The indicator uses up to 500 lines and boxes for extensions and visuals, ensuring compatibility with TradingView limits. It is overlay=true, so it plots directly on the price chart.

How Length Adaptation Works
Market Regimes Identified:
The system identifies 4 distinct market conditions based on the 12 features:
Regime 1 (Green): Calm, ranging market → Shorter EMAs (more responsive)
Regime 2 (Blue): Strong trending market → Medium-length EMAs (balance speed/noise)
Regime 3 (Red): High volatility/choppy → Longer EMAs (filter noise)
Regime 4 (Gray): Transitional/neutral → Moderate EMAs (adaptive middle ground)
Adaptation Formula:
Each EMA length is calculated as:
Final Length = Base Length × Regime Multiplier × Volatility Adjustment × Momentum Adjustment × Entropy Adjustment
Where:
Regime Multiplier: 0.3x to 2.5x depending on market type
Volatility Adjustment: Increases length during high volatility (filters noise)
Momentum Adjustment: Based on RSI - extreme readings adjust sensitivity
Entropy Adjustment: Lower entropy (trending) = tighter EMAs
Key Adaptive Features
1. Volatility Response
When market volatility increases:
EMAs lengthen automatically to avoid whipsaws
Calculated using ATR weighted by volume
2. Volume Integration
Higher volume makes the system:
React faster to price changes
Increase learning rate
Trust the current move more
3. Correlation Analysis
Short-term correlation: Detects immediate momentum
Long-term correlation: Confirms overall trend stability
Adjusts EMA sensitivity accordingly
4. Entropy Monitoring
Measures market "disorder"
Trending markets → Tighter EMAs (follow trend)
Choppy markets → Wider EMAs (reduce noise)

RV − IV Spread Alert (SPY vs VIX)Realized vs Implied Volatility Spread (RV − IV) for the S&P 500 / SPY.
Plots the daily difference between 30-day realized volatility (SPY) and implied volatility (VIX) in basis points.
Key insight from the research: when the spread turns and stays above ≈ +50 bps, forward returns historically degrade and volatility of returns rises sharply — a useful early-warning regime flag.

MMBS HkOrE FX [V5.11]The Multi-Model Bias System (MMBS) is a composite bias-detection framework that evaluates price behavior using three independent analytical engines: structural confirmation, normalized volatility expansion, and momentum velocity dynamics. The goal of the tool is not to generate trading signals, but to identify the dominant directional bias through multi-factor validation.
🔧 1. Structural Recognition Engine (Multi-Pivot Confirmation)
MMBS identifies market structure using a multi-confirmation pivot model rather than a single swing point.
A Swing High/Low is only confirmed when several consecutive pivot conditions align.
This reduces noise and produces a “stable structure map.”
A bullish bias requires sequential higher-low and higher-high confirmations; bearish bias requires the opposite.
Because this model relies on progressive confirmation, it behaves differently from common fractal-based structure indicators.
This approach allows the bias to remain stable during minor price fluctuations.
🔧 2. Normalized Volatility Boundary (Modified ATR Model)
Volatility is processed using a custom ATR-based normalization:
The script calculates a rolling ATR range, then scales it using a smoothing function to prevent extreme expansion.
This produces a volatility boundary line that adapts proportionally to recent market conditions.
When price approaches this boundary while structural strength weakens, the system flags reduced confidence in the existing bias.
This method differs from standard ATR bands because it compresses outlier volatility instead of amplifying it.
🔧 3. Momentum Velocity Engine (Smoothed ROC Filter)
The momentum module measures acceleration rather than raw momentum:
A smoothed Rate-of-Change curve evaluates whether price velocity is supporting or diverging from the current structure.
Deceleration near the volatility boundary is interpreted as potential instability.
No buy/sell signals are generated—momentum is used strictly for bias confidence filtering.
By focusing on velocity shifts instead of momentum direction alone, the system captures early structural weakening.
🔗 How the Components Interact
A directional bias is assigned only when:
Structure confirmation
Volatility normalization
Momentum velocity
are aligned in the same direction.
If any module diverges, MMBS defaults to a neutral (no-bias) state.
This behavior distinguishes it from single-module indicators that rely solely on trend, volatility, or momentum.
